7187882: TEST_BUG: java/rmi/activation/checkusage/CheckUsage.java fails intermittently
Summary: Tighten up JavaVM test library API, and adjust tests to match.
Reviewed-by: mchung, dmocek

+    /**
+     * Waits for the subprocess to exit, joins the pipe threads to ensure that
+     * all output is collected, and returns its exit status.
+     */
+    public int waitFor() throws InterruptedException {
+        if (vm == null)
+            throw new IllegalStateException("can't wait for JavaVM that hasn't started");
+
+        int status = vm.waitFor();
+        outPipe.join();
+        errPipe.join();
+        return status;
+    }
+
+    /**
+     * Starts the subprocess, waits for it to exit, and returns its exit status.
+     */
+    public int execute() throws IOException, InterruptedException {
+        start();
+        return waitFor();
     }
